Java Swing app looks tiny on high-DPI screen when it should be scaled to normal size


How can I make my Java Swing app GUI scale properly to users on high-DPI screens?

See the screenshot below. At the top you can see how tiny the app looks compared to Ubuntu's file explorer icons and gedit. In the bottom left you can see roughly what size the app should look like (and does look on regular DPI monitors). So I'm looking for a way to scale the GUI of the app properly when a high DPI monitor is in use. For example, gedit looks the same on both regular DPI and high DPI monitors. I want my app to behave like this.

This is an extremely common problem affecting many apps. Roughly half of the apps I run on Ubuntu are scaled properly without any actions from the user, the other half are not scaled and look really tiny. Note that I'm mainly looking for a solution that doesn't require actions from the user (although any help is appreciated at this point - I haven't found any ways to scale it at all).

According to this scaling should already work out of the box. It doesn't. I'm not sure if this is a bug or if there is some additional step I'm supposed to do besides running the app on Java 9?


Solution

  • You have to tell the drawing libraries to scale the app up.

    GDK_SCALE=2 ./application

    Will have the appropriate information set in the environment and the widgets will render scaled up such that each pixel effectively takes four pixels of footprint.

    Note that the splash screen (if you use Java's splash screen support) isn't presented after the entire Swing libraries are loaded, so it won't scale regardless of the settings you attempt.

    In some platforms, like the Linux distribution of Fedora, partial scaling is also possible, such that you can set GDK_SCALE=1.5. Just keep in mind that it's not universally available, and it is not settable to any scaling ratio you might want.

    Finally, the older JVMs ignore this setting completely, so if you aren't launching with Java 9 or higher, odds are it won't work. And, of course, the way that things are tweaked for older JVMs and different operating systems tend to vary (if they work at all).
